Sports massage is based on Swedish massage and uses a range of different techniques to help prevent and treat sports injuries. These include effleurage, kneading, deep tissue work and stretching. Sports massage can be done before a sports event to stimulate circulation and reduce the risk of injury or after an event or training session to help relieve muscle soreness.
Improves flexibility of muscles and jointsIncreases blood circulation and reduces swellingSpeeds up healing of damaged tissuesHelps with the removal of lactic acid to reduce muscle soreness
